TURN-208: Gatevale turnstile counters at the Merrow Field pilot double-count when a rotation reverses mid-cycle. Attendance totals drift roughly 2% high per event. The debounce window fix is implemented, reviewed by Ilsa, and soak-tested across two simulated match days without drift. Ready for your cut; the candidate build is identified below.

trace token, tagag-tafog: htk6_5ed18c

- [ ] **Step 7: Breaker override escrow.** After sealing the signing keys for the Tallgrove upstream API circuit breaker, confirm the support team can force the breaker open during a full outage. The override bundle lives in the sealed escrow drawer and is useless without its unlock phrase. Two ceremony witnesses must initial this step before proceeding. The escrow bundle is decrypted with the recovery passphrase that follows.

vault phrase of kahip-kahop = holath-quenmir

## Releases

Flagpole rollouts ship weekly, usually Tuesday. If you're on call, know that a release is just a signed manifest of flag defaults plus the evaluator binary — clients refuse anything unsigned, which is exactly what you want during an incident. To cut an emergency release, run the `flagpole cut` task, let CI build the manifest, then sign it locally before pushing to the distribution bucket. Rollbacks are the same flow with the previous manifest. Sign emergency manifests with the on-call key:

deploy key for yajop-fahop: bky3_h1v